No clutch pedal, replaced master... bled system, had clutch for a while, gone again?
Any ideas? Lost the clutch pedal prior and had to get it towed to the garage. Finally go a 01-02 Master into the car and bled it, felt like we had a pretty good pedal for a while. Let the car sit for about 30 minutes, and it was gone again.
Any ideas?
Reservoir is topped off and doesn't appear to be leaking fluid anywhere.

Yes, I've popped the (used 01-02 updated hydraulic w/ drill mod) master cylinder line out of the transmission and noticed that the end of the fitting had been damaged. I'm currently seeking a refund with the seller and looking for a different MC.
I am pretty confident the system was slowly leaking pressure from where this fitting is damaged after we had bled it, which is why we would have a clutch again for 30 min or so and be able to drive the car, then come back to nothing until being re-bled.
